Output 10bb157a76fe15665ad15ed27919aeeafb4cdbd5d3bb34707833b86036d5620c:24

value
95113
script pubkey
OP_0 OP_PUSHBYTES_20 1f387a1fa3fac82291db8360f8d76eb0a2dceb5f
address
bc1qruu858arltyz9ywmsds034mwkz3de66l6ra4nc
transaction
10bb157a76fe15665ad15ed27919aeeafb4cdbd5d3bb34707833b86036d5620c